Email Help: Detail and Response Time
Email is for the less urgent, more complicated stuff. We sent queries asking for clarification on bonus eligibility and for copies of old transaction records. Replies landed in our inbox between 6 and 12 hours later. The answers were methodical, tackling each part of our question. You could sometimes tell they were using template sentences. The major benefit of email is the paper trail. Having a written record of a promise or a solution is invaluable, especially if you’re dealing with a disputed transaction.
Chat Support Performance and Speed

In cases where something goes wrong, you want an answer right away. Live chat is the tool for that. We reached out at varying times, like busy Australian evenings. We hardly ever waited more than two minutes to reach a real person. The staff were polite and quick with simple tasks, like changing a password. For harder problems, like checking a delayed withdrawal, the chat agent was unable to solve it immediately. Rather, they noted the details and promised a follow-up by email, which arrived. It functions as an efficient first triage.
Agent Skill and Problem-Solving Effectiveness
Politeness is one thing https://napoleoncasino.eu/en-au/. Fixing your problem is a different matter. The help desk handled regular tasks with confidence. But when we raised a atypical case, like a potential bug in a specific game, things dragged. The agent was clearly following a script. They politely sought to escalate the problem to a technical team. This is the correct procedure, but it means you won’t get an quick resolution. You receive an confirmation and a greater delay for a resolution.

Region-specific Payment and Bonus Inquiry Handling
We went deeper with questions relevant to Australia. We queried widely used local payment methods and the terms and conditions on promotions targeted at Aussie players. The agents were aware of the basics about deposit options like credit cards and e-wallets. But their knowledge had limits. On some specific bonus questions, they defaulted to asking us to check the terms and conditions page ourselves. For straightforward answers, they were fine. For anything requiring deep, localised knowledge, they sometimes had to pass the query along.
